Chandler Smith – No. 18 JBL Tundra Camping World Trucks Daytona Road Course Preview

Chandler Smith will make his first NASCAR Camping World Truck Series road course start behind the wheel of Kyle Busch Motorsports’ (KBM) No. 18 JBL Tundra in Friday night’s BrakeBest Brake Pads 159 at the Daytona International Speedway Road Course.

Parker Chase – No. 51 Vertical Bridge Tundra Camping World Trucks Daytona Road Course Preview

Parker Chase will make his NASCAR Camping World Truck Series debut behind the wheel of the No. 51 Vertical Bridge Tundra in Friday night’s 159-mile event at the 3.61-mile, 14-turn Daytona International Speedway Road Course.

Hendrick Motorsports Media Advance: Naval Base Coronado

Hendrick Motorsports has the all-time lead in NASCAR Cup Series poles (27), wins (31), top-fives (104), top-10s (174) and laps led (2,462) on road courses.
